Anyway, he has a 98 GTS with the Penske coilover suspension and Eibach springs. This past Saturday we decided to lower the car more than what the previous owner had in an effort to achieve a certain look. He had lowered the vehicle about an inch and had it aligned as you should. We lowered his GTS another 1/2 an inch. The car looks great but now my friend says the rear end feels very loose and comes around much easier than before. Now I know the car needs to be realigned obviously but I find it hard to belive that such a minimal adjustment in ride height would have such a drastic effect on the handling. Any comments or suggestions or similar experiences?

Dave is right on. Lowering the car without realigning it will result in higher negative camber and less toe-in (more toe out). You may have ended up with toe-out in the rear which makes the car feel unstable.

You imply that the car has been lowered by 1 and 1/2 inches from original factory settings. That is way too much for the suspension geometry to work in your favor. You should go back up at least 1/2 inch.

For good road course handling, at the axle centerline, the distance from the ground to the bottom of the frame should be about 4-1/4". Look for about 4-5/8" to 4-3/4" in the rear, using scales and your corner weights to dial the exact ride height in.

Way too much lowering. Roll centers get bad quickly when you go too far. Toe out at the rear is to be avoided at all cost. Frank's ride height recommendations are very good, but a street car that low will scrape frequently and you'll begin losing side sill screws.
